Alex Bruce has claimed that Rangers would welcome any cash injection from potential investor Stuart Gibson.
Speaking exclusively to Ibrox News, the former Kilmarnock defender suggested that a financial boost from the lifelong Gers fan could be a vital factor in helping the club “bridge the gap” between themselves and Celtic at the top of the Scottish Premiership.
The Daily Record reported last week that the property mogul is on the cusp of putting an extra £20 million into the Glaswegian giants, but has no intention of bidding for a majority stake in the club.
And Bruce believes that the move could be hugely positive for the Gers, should it come to fruition.
Speaking to Ibrox News, he said: “There’s always been rumours that the finances are still not the best, but obviously any injection of funds to any club is going to be beneficial.
“That’s especially true in Scotland where the level of money the teams and the players make isn’t the same as the English Premier League.
“Any influence or any incoming cash will sure as hell boost Rangers to go and try and bridge that gap between themselves and Celtic.”
Gibson is a die hard Rangers fan, but is currently based in the Middle East, where he has amassed a considerable personal wealth through real estate dealings.
While he is yet to make an official statement on his reported interest in the club, a source close to the businessman has confirmed that he is keen to support the Gers financially.
